# Break-Glass Access: Lanternfold GraphQL Service

During the N+1 fix on the Lanternfold resolver layer, emergency access may be required if the dataloader rollout degrades query latency. Reviewers should confirm the batching change before invoking break-glass. If escalation is unavoidable, unlock the Harridge emergency vault using the recovery passphrase recorded directly below.

recovery phrase for fawif-tajeg: norael-aldmir-casir-brivan-ulaion

Runbook: Vextra Admin dark mode. Toggle ships behind flag `ui.theme.dark`. Enable per-tenant only; global rollout waits for contrast audit sign-off. If charts render with white backgrounds, clear the theme cache and redeploy the asset bundle. Rollback: flip the flag off; no migration involved. Verify against the Harlow staging tenant before promoting. The build that passed the audit is listed below.

build token for tawip-yageg: htk9_92ac43d42

Nightly reindex (Harrowgate search) runs 01:30–03:00. Plugin-supplied analyzers load at job start; a bad analyzer fails the whole run. If your plugin is named in the failure log: fix, republish, notify. Do not request a manual reindex yourself. Escalation order: check status page, check plugin changelog, then escalate to the index ops rotation. Severity 1 only if morning search is fully stale. Include plugin version and failure timestamp in your report. Escalations and questions go to the rotation here.

escalation mailbox, yajeg-bageg: quenax.olidor@lumiccorp.internal

**Re: sweeper loop in `orphan_reaper.go`** — Flagging this for the eng sync. The sweeper now deletes any Cloudbarn volume with no owning workload record, but the ownership lookup races against provisioning: a volume created moments before the sweep can look orphaned. I'd suggest a minimum-age grace period and a two-pass confirm before deletion, since a false positive here destroys customer data. The thresholds I'd propose, based on provisioning latencies we measured last quarter, are these.

limits module of fajog-tawig:
RATE_LIMITS = {
    "druwyn": 2,
    "quenael": 10,
    "wenix": 2,
    "druael": 2,
}